Joshua Tree National Park (JOTR) has a need to stay current with GIS processes and technologies. With the mandatory sequestration that occurred several years ago, JOTR has lost the capacity to host a full time NPS employee dedicated to GIS, the associated projects, and maintaining and updating associated software systems.
